Engineering is more than just coding and testing. It's also about sharing your knowledge with others. Most engineering leaders I follow use services that do not respect customer privacy. As an engineering FOSS community, we are responsible for showing everyone the way and helping them build their online presence using the tools and approaches that respect the values behind our movement.

I'll lead you through a journey of discovering tools, platforms, and ways of sharing your knowledge and content and positioning yourself as a leader in a way that focuses on privacy first.


We will be covering tools like:
- Mastodon
- Peertube
-WriteFreely

...and touching terms like:
- what is a brand and why do you need it
- why the modern tools we use are harming us

and what we can do to solve this.

A very practical topic with lots of examples and interactions with you.
